DAC Women's Basketball Post-season Tournament pairings announced; live coverage will be available
February 23, 2010
Black Hills State is the top seed for the DAC Women's Basketball Post-season Basketball Championships, which begin on Wednesday, Feb. 24th. The Trojans will be the seventh seed in the tournament.
The top four seeds will be the host of the first round of the DAC tournament on Wednesday. The winners of Wednesday's games will play in the semifinals on Sunday, Feb. 28th at the two highest seeds remaining. The championship game is slated on Tuesday, March 2nd at the highest seed. The winner of the DAC Post-season tournament will earn an automatic bid to the NAIA Division II Women's Basketball National Championship tournament in Sioux City, Iowa.
